作 者:葛承垄 贾晨星 明月伟 GE Chenglong;JIA Chenxing;MING Yuewei(Joint Operation College of National Defense University,Shijiazhuang 050084,China)
机构地区:[1]国防大学联合作战学院指挥信息系统演训中心,河北石家庄050084
出 处:《指挥控制与仿真》2024年第6期1-7,共7页Command Control & Simulation
摘 要:作战概念是联合作战的重要表现形式,是新质作战力量建设运用的重要驱动力。针对战争形态快速嬗变的实际,单纯以文字撰写为主要方式的作战概念创新已不能满足未来作战的需求,迫切需要从工程化视角对作战概念开发进行科学规范。在深入分析作战概念开发国内外研究现状基础上,科学归纳了作战概念开发的描述、设计和验证三类典型需求,提出了一种“四层六段”架构的作战概念开发框架,详细分析了该开发框架的主要内容、内部逻辑、基本流程和方法工具,为开发具体的作战概念提供参考框架。Operational concept is an important manifestation of joint operation and an important driving force for the construction and application of new combat forces.In response to the rapid transformation of the war form,the innovation of operational concept based on solely writing cannot meet the needs of future operations.It is urgent to scientifically standardize the development of operational concept from an engineering perspective.On the basis of deeply analysis of the current research status of operational concept development at home and abroad,three typical requirements for describing,designing and verifying operational concept development are scientifically summarized.A operational concept development framework with four-layer and six-segment architecture is proposed and the main content,internal logic,basic processes,methods and tools of the development framework are analyzed in detail to provide a framework reference for developing specific operational concept.
